Sorption working pairs, which can convert low-grade heat into cold energy or seasonally store thermal energy, are potential future carbon-neutral materials for thermal management. This Comment highlights the superiorities of metal–organic framework (MOF)–ammonia working pairs for adaptable thermal management under extreme climates and discusses strategies to design MOFs with high stability and ammonia sorption capacity.
